[QUOTE="Hugnot, post: 2624404, member: 115658"] No problems here with .224 75 ELDM's at 3150 from a 7.7 twist. From a 7 twist at 3150 bullets have RPM's bigger than 300,000. I don't know, but your 7-twist barrel was intended for much milder chambered rounds like .223 with 2750 fps velocities. [ATTACH]396041[/ATTACH][ATTACH]396042[/ATTACH] Stability problems might occur with slower speeds & cold temperatures with an 8- twist. My experiences with the 88's were disappointing compared with the 75's that were 150 fps faster & had equal form factors. [/QUOTE]
